Wake vs Viewing

A viewing is a dedicated time for guests to see the body before burial or cremation. The atmosphere is usually calm and reflective, with the body present in a casket, allowing loved ones a final moment of connection. This setting is often structured and quiet, giving individuals space to process their emotions privately.

A wake, by contrast, centers more on togetherness. While some wakes include the body, many do not. Instead, the focus is on shared stories, prayer, and comforting the family as a group. Guests may gather around photographs, candles, or memorial displays, creating a sense of warmth and support that feels different from the stillness of a viewing.

Wake vs Visitation: Subtle but Important Differences

Wake vs Visitation: When comparing a wake vs a visitation, the distinction is mostly in tone and purpose.
A visitation is generally quieter and more structured. Guests come for a short period to offer condolences, speak briefly with the family, and spend a private moment reflecting on the loss. It usually takes place at a funeral home before the main service and doesn’t include long prayers, communal stories, or rituals.

By contrast, a wake often carries a more open, communal atmosphere. Depending on cultural or religious traditions, it may involve shared stories, prayers, or extended hours where loved ones can gather, support each other, and honor the person’s life together.

Visitation vs Funeral Service

A visitation is an informal period of gathering, not a ceremony. Guests arrive at their own pace, speak with the family, and view the loved one or memorial arrangements if they wish.

A funeral service, on the other hand, follows a set program. It may include readings, eulogies, selected music, and religious or cultural rites designed to honor the person’s life in a more formal way. What to Wear to a Wake

Knowing what to wear to a wake can ease anxiety for first-time attendees. The goal is to show respect while remaining understated. Soft, neutral colors like black, navy, gray, or muted pastels are appropriate. Avoid flashy patterns or overly casual attire such as shorts or bright, loud clothing.

While formal attire isn’t necessary, choosing outfits that are neat, modest, and simple shows consideration for the family. How Long to Stay at a Wake

Understanding how long to stay at a wake helps attendees feel confident and respectful. Typically, 20 to 45 minutes is sufficient to greet the family, offer condolences, and spend a moment in reflection. This timeframe allows meaningful interaction while giving space for other guests.

If you were especially close to the deceased, or if the family welcomes extended conversations, it’s appropriate to stay longer.
